Transaction 24f75888776c50912b5bab354e18206314dcce603fb7bcc55e19ca98abee96eb

1 Input
2 Outputs
  • 24f75888776c50912b5bab354e18206314dcce603fb7bcc55e19ca98abee96eb:0
  • value  2409882
    address  33jdoiFPQ2QRZDo9shfgiSMWvk55TAhvzm
  • 24f75888776c50912b5bab354e18206314dcce603fb7bcc55e19ca98abee96eb:1
  • value  284898
    address  3LXA3kxqA3DBrmv58gswY54XpRrG2JpGDo